As a plastic surgeon, I need to stress that the effectiveness and time of achieving results after plastic surgery can vary from person to person. This depends on multiple factors, including the specific procedure, individual body characteristics, and post-operative care. In general, after plastic surgery, it takes some time for the body to heal and for the final results to become apparent. Immediately after the surgery, there may be swelling, bruising, and discomfort, which are normal reactions. These symptoms usually subside gradually over the following weeks and months. For the ThreeForMe procedure, the recovery time and the visibility of results can also depend on various factors. typically, patients can start to see some initial improvements within a few weeks, but the full effects may take several months to a year to develop. It's important to note that everyone's healing process is unique, and some individuals may experience different results and recovery times. During the recovery period, it is crucial to follow the post-operative instructions given by the surgeon. This may include proper wound care, avoiding certain activities, and wearing compression garments, depending on the specific procedure. Additionally, maintaining a healthy lifestyle with a balanced diet, adequate rest, and avoiding smoking can also contribute to optimal healing. It's important to have realistic expectations regarding the outcome of plastic surgery. While the ThreeForMe procedure can provide significant improvements, it may not achieve perfect results for everyone. Factors such as individual anatomy, pre-existing conditions, and the skill and experience of the surgeon can all impact the final outcome. If you are considering the ThreeForMe procedure in Alotau or any other location, I highly recommend consulting with a qualified and experienced plastic surgeon. They can assess your specific situation, discuss your goals and expectations, and provide personalized advice on the potential results and recovery time. Remember, plastic surgery is a medical decision that should be made after careful consideration and informed consent.
